摘要: m:model 数据层,(js来定义的一些数据,可能是死的数据,也可能是从服务器获取来的数据,当然还有一些更复杂的数据) v: view 视图层(用来展现给用户看的,dom结构) vm: view-model 视图模型层(vue实例 ,data-banding,dom-listner) mvvm原理 阅读全文
posted @ 2020-08-13 13:32 颿華正茂 阅读(140) 评论(0) 推荐(0)
摘要: 迭代器是用来遍历数据的接口, 当我们需要自定义遍历数据时,就要用到迭代器 工作原理 1.创建一个指针对象,指向当前数据结构的起始位置 2.第一次调用对象的的next方法,指针自动指向数据结构的第一个成员 3.接下来不断调用next方法,指针一直往后移动,直道指向最后一个成员 4.每调用next方法返 阅读全文
posted @ 2020-08-04 13:22 颿華正茂 阅读(119) 评论(0) 推荐(0)
摘要: git是一个版本控制系统,我们每次写完一个版本的代码可以保存到里面,如果需要某个版本就可以拉取下来。 git的三个区, 1.安装git:去git官网下载安装完成后:git 的全局配置: $ git config -l 查看配置信息 $ git config --global -l 查看全局配置信息 阅读全文
posted @ 2020-07-28 21:32 颿華正茂 阅读(87) 评论(0) 推荐(0)
摘要: 箭头函数 var add = (a,b)=>{} 箭头函数:用来简化函数定义语法 (形参)=>{执行语句} 如果函数体中只有一句代码,且代码的执行结果就是返回值,可以省略大括号 如果形参只有一个,则,可以省略小括号 箭头函数不绑定this,箭头函数中的this,指向是函数定义位置的上下文this。 阅读全文
posted @ 2020-07-28 13:02 颿華正茂 阅读(88) 评论(0) 推荐(0)
摘要: //数组解构 let [a,b,c]=[1,2,3]; console.log(a); console.log(b); console.log(c); //如果解构不成功 let [d,f]=[1]; console.log(d); console.log(f);//值为undefined还可以传默 阅读全文
posted @ 2020-07-27 21:30 颿華正茂 阅读(87) 评论(0) 推荐(0)
摘要: let:let声明的变量只有所处于的块级有效 当业务逻辑比较复杂的时候,可以防止内层变量覆盖外层变量 在一个大括号中使用let关键字声明的变量才具有块级作用域,var不具备 防止循环变量变成全局变量 使用let关键字声明的变量,不存在变量提升 if(true){ let a=10; console. 阅读全文
posted @ 2020-07-27 20:50 颿華正茂 阅读(144) 评论(0) 推荐(0)
摘要: doomTree 将jhtml结构按树的方式挂起来(深度优先原则,先看左侧,再看右侧) html head body title meta div p a csstree 当domtree形成后,会形成一个与domtree相类似的csstree doomtree+csstree=randertree 阅读全文
posted @ 2020-07-26 20:38 颿華正茂 阅读(197) 评论(0) 推荐(0)
摘要: document.getElementById()方法定义在Document.prototype上,所以Element节点上不能使用 document.getElementsByName()方法定义在HTMLDocument.prototype上,即非html中的document不能使用 docum 阅读全文
posted @ 2020-07-26 15:13 颿華正茂 阅读(124) 评论(0) 推荐(0)
摘要: 选项卡功能 <button type="button" class="change">1</button> <button type="button">2</button> <button type="button">3</button> <div class="cont active">第一个框框 阅读全文
posted @ 2020-07-26 14:19 颿華正茂 阅读(93) 评论(0) 推荐(0)
摘要: es3和es5产生冲突的部分使用es5的方法,否则使用es3 “use strict” 变量赋值前必须声明,var a=b=2;(b没有定义) 局部this必须被赋值 赋给什么就是什么 拒绝重复属性和参数 arguments.calle 不能被使用 function.caller with:改变作用 阅读全文
posted @ 2020-07-26 12:02 颿華正茂 阅读(94) 评论(0) 推荐(0)